WebNov 18, 2024 · All you need is your Medicare card and military ID as proof of coverage. You may visit any authorized provider. >>Find a Doctor In most cases, your provider files your claims with Medicare. Medicare pays its portion and sends the claim to the TRICARE For Life claims processor.

WebMedicare Advantage Plans. If you have Part A and Part B, you can join a Medicare Advantage Plan, sometimes called “Part C” or an “MA plan.” This type of Medicare health plan is offered by Medicare-approved private companies that must follow rules set by Medicare. Most Medicare Advantage Plans include drug coverage (Part D) .
